Legal update: key legislative changes
In this session, we will be joined by Birketts' Charlotte Wormstone and Alice Harris for what promises to be a dynamic and insightful session tackling some of the most pressing legal challenges in today’s property market. Join us as their team breaks down key developments shaping the industry, including the latest on leasehold reform and the legal pushback to the Leasehold and Freehold Reform Act 2024. Discover what's next for commonhold ownership with highlights from the new Commonhold White Paper. Also get up to speed on the transformative Renters Rights Bill, from its headline changes to its real-world impact on the private rented sector.

Charlotte Wormstone Partner, Birketts

Charlotte is a Partner in the Property Disputes team at Birketts and co-heads the specialist Leasehold Enfranchisement sector. Charlotte deals with all aspects of contentious property matters, including commercial landlord and tenant, real property rights (restrictive covenants, easements and boundary matters) and residential development land disputes. She specialises in leasehold enfranchisement including matters concerning tenants’ rights of first refusal arising under the Landlord and Tenant Act 1987, long lease residential disputes and property related insolvency issues.
